A fancy twist on a grilled cheese. Bacon Grilled Cheese Sandwich is cooked until golden and gooey loaded with fresh basil, tomatoes, and mozzarella cheese on hearty artisan bread. Perfectly crispy, perfectly cheesy, and perfectly delightful!

I’m a pretty big fan of sandwiches for lunch or dinner, like this White Bean Cheddar Melt, Garlic and Dill Flank Steak Sliders or  Turkey Caesar Sandwich on Garlic Toast.

Be sure to sign up for my email… to get new recipes and ideas in your inbox!

Turkey Bacon and Avocado Grilled Cheese sandwich loaded with fresh basil, tomatoes and mozzarella cheese on a hearty artisan bread. Recipe at TidyMom.net

The Perfect Bacon Grilled Cheese Sandwich

I have a thing for good sandwiches.  They need to have lots of texture and lots of flavor.  This Bacon Grilled Cheese hit it out of the park!!  It’s a little like a BLAT (Bacon Lettuce Avocado Tomato) meets grilled cheese.

Everyone knows how to make a classic grilled cheese… I know, but let me tell you, this sandwich is not your average grilled cheese sandwich. It is anything but. The flavors from the basil, turkey (or pork) bacon, avocado, and tomato mingle together with the melty mozzarella and crusty toasted buttered bread to make this sandwich extra special.

This has been one of those sandwiches that I like to just keep in my arsenal of quick, easy, and absolutely delicious go-to recipes.  Great for summer, because you don’t have to heat up the house, yet you still have a hot meal to put on the table. My whole family loves this bacon grilled cheese sandwich!

Butterball Turkey Bacon

How To Make A Bacon Grilled Cheese

This sandwich starts off with turkey bacon, for a lighter and flavorful alternative to pork bacon.  I usually cook the whole package of turkey bacon, because Steve loves to snack on the leftover pieces.

Turkey Bacon and Avocado Grilled Cheese sandwich. Recipe at TidyMom.net

What’s On a Bacon Grilled Cheese Sandwich

  • I like to use thick slices of hearty artisan bread, so it yields a nice crunch, once it’s toasted.
  • If you’d like to go with the classic BLAT, you could use a lettuce of your choice, but I love to use basil leaves for an unexpected added flavor, with the juicy tomatoes and buttery avocados, it’s magical!
  • As for the mozzarella, buy the best you can afford.  It’s so creamy and melty and worth it.
  • We love this bacon sandwich with turkey or pork bacon.
  • Unsalted butter for getting that golden toasted bread.
Turkey Bacon and Avocado Grilled Cheese sandwich recipe at TidyMom.net
  1. While the turkey bacon is cooking, slice the bread, tomatoes, and avocado.
  2. Butter one side of each slice of bread.
  3. Once the bacon is cooked, lay a bread butter side down in the skillet, layer with cheese, turkey bacon, avocado, tomatoes, and basil, and top with another slice of bread (buttered side up).
  4. Cook over medium-high heat until golden and glorious and the cheese becomes melty.
  5. Remove from skillet and enjoy!
Turkey Bacon and Avocado Grilled Cheese sandwich loaded with fresh basil, tomatoes and mozzarella cheese on a hearty artisan bread. Recipe at TidyMom.net

Of course, you could split this bacon avocado goodness with someone……. but who am I kidding, it’s not like I shared my Bacon Grilled Cheese with anyone 😉  Just sayin’.

Like This Recipe? Pin It!

pinterest-image
grilled cheese sandwich with bacon and avocado cut in half and stacked

More Turkey Recipes To Enjoy!

MAKE A TURKEY BACON AND AVOCADO GRILLED CHEESE EVERY DAY!

Who says you can’t eat the same thing every day?! If it were up to me every day would be a grilled cheese day because it’s just that good! If you’re looking for a simple hot sandwich that everyone will love, then look no further. This recipe is a sure-fire crowd-pleaser! 

Turkey Bacon and Avocado Grilled Cheese sandwich loaded with fresh basil, tomatoes and mozzarella cheese on a hearty artisan bread. Recipe at TidyMom.net

Bacon Grilled Cheese With Avocado

Yield: 2 sandwiches
Prep Time: 2 minutes
Cook Time: 7 minutes
Total Time: 9 minutes

Bacon and Avocado Grilled Cheese sandwich loaded with fresh basil, tomatoes, and mozzarella cheese on hearty artisan bread.

Ingredients

  • 4 slices hearty artisan bread
  • 4-6 slices bacon, cooked (pork or turkey)
  • 4 slices mozzarella
  • 1 small avocado, sliced
  • 1 ripe tomato, sliced
  • 6 basil leaves
  • 1-2 tablespoons of butter

Instructions

  1. Butter one side of each of the slices of bread.
  2. Pace 2 slices of bread, butter side down in a skillet or griddle.  Layer with mozzarella, bacon, avocado, tomato, and basil. Top with remaining slices of buttered bread (butter side up).
  3. Heat over medium-high heat and top sandwiches with the remaining slices of bread, butter-side-up, and cook until golden and the cheese begins to melt - about 4 minutes (you can cover with a lid to speed up the melting process.)
  4. Carefully flip the sandwich, reduce heat to medium, and cook a few more minutes until the cheese has melted and the bread is golden brown.
  5. Slice in half and serve.
Nutrition Information:
Yield: 2 Serving Size: 1
Amount Per Serving: Calories: 666Total Fat: 43gSaturated Fat: 16gTrans Fat: 0gUnsaturated Fat: 24gCholesterol: 83mgSodium: 1103mgCarbohydrates: 43gFiber: 9gSugar: 6gProtein: 29g

Nutrition information is estimated based on the ingredients and cooking instructions as described in each recipe and is intended to be used for informational purposes only. Please note that nutrition details may vary based on methods of preparation, origin, and freshness of ingredients used and are just estimates. We encourage, especially if these numbers are important to you, to calculate these on your own for most accurate results.

Did you make this recipe?

Please leave a comment on the blog or share a photo on Instagram

Turkey Bacon and Avocado Grilled Cheese sandwich loaded with fresh basil, tomatoes and mozzarella cheese on a hearty artisan bread.